El Farolitos soccer dream runs aground in Sacramento

San Francisco, CALocal News

El Farolito's aspirations in the U. S. Open Cup came to an abrupt halt with a 1-0 loss to Sacramento Republic in Sacramento. From the outset, the amateur team displayed eagerness that translated into anxious play, impacting their overall performance. A pivotal moment occurred when Sebastián Herrera scored a header in the 29th minute, putting El Farolito at a disadvantage.

Despite this setback, goalkeeper Johan Lizarralde's remarkable saves kept hope alive for the team. The Burrito Brava supporters, unwavering in their enthusiasm, created an electrifying atmosphere, making their presence felt even miles away from home. Post-match, the somber mood among family members underscored the emotional weight of the defeat, with sentiments expressing that the pain of losing outweighed any monetary losses. Coach Santiago López's commitment to the team was evident as he maximized player involvement throughout the match. El Farolito, a symbol of working-class resilience, is determined to bounce back and continue their journey in the upcoming season.
